DESCRIPTION

The FED30W series offer 30 watts of output power from a 2 x 1 x 0.4 inch package. FED30W series have 4:1 ultra wide input voltage of 9 ~36 and 18 ~75VDC. The FED30W have features 1600VDC of isolation, short circuit protection, over-current protection, over-voltage protection, over-temperature protection and six sided shielding.

The FED30W series standard module meets EN55022 Cl ass A and Class B with external components. For more detail information, please contact with P-DUKE. 8. An external filter capacitor is required if the mo dule has to meet EN61000-4-4,EN61000-4-5. The filter capacitor Power Mate suggest: 24 VDC INPUT : Nippon chemi-con KY series, 330 µF/50V. 48 VDC INPUT : Nippon chemi-con KY series, 220 µF/100V. CAUTION: This power module is not internally fused. An input line fuse must always be used.
